We will start with the good news.
The New Orleans Pelicans lost Monday evening, which means the Warriors have clinched a spot in the play-in tournament.
Now for the bad news.

The team that beat the Pelicans was the Memphis Grizzlies, who have moved into a tie with the Warriors for the No. 8 seed in the Western Conference.
But both teams won't be 35-33 for long, as Golden State currently is playing the Utah Jazz at Chase Center.
So the Warriors will end the night either 0.5 games ahead of the Grizzlies, or 0.5 games behind the Grizzlies.

Golden State and Memphis will do battle on the final day of the regular season. And it's very possible that the winner of Sunday's showdown will secure the No. 8 seed in the play-in.
